I think it is the same with the vampire trope. I think you can tell a lot about a person from what tropes and characters they like. It reflects our own desires in life and partner.
For women safety with a man is a lot more important than for men with women and this is something men constantly miss and misunderstand. A man can be both a shield and a sword and sometimes it is directed at you instead of others… At least that’s become my understanding…
Interestingly enough being the ‘protector’ is a very common trope amongst men’s media and plays into the above. Yet it rarely deals with the other side. Instead it is about being chosen to be the ‘protector’ by the woman and protect her from other men.
The woman for this reason is often rather more passive, since she will choose him after he has proven his worth by defeating the bad man trying to hurt her. Her choice is determined by his actions, not by her preference or actions. The female love interest in men’s media therefore often don’t have much agency, she isn’t striving for anything, she is just there to be convinced.
In women’s media on the other hand, women often have more agency and are more active in the choice, often deliberating between multiple men and her actions and drive determines the outcome. Meanwhile the men, while not passive, are single mindedly interested in her and driven by gaining her favour (it would of course be a poor romance if he wasn’t interested in her, but men have other goals in life than chasing women!).
Really quite interesting and telling about our society and culture if you ask me.
